Method
Soup Preparation
- 1
- 2
Add Potatoes and Broth
Add the diced potatoes to the pot and pour in the vegetable broth.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er until the potatoes are tender, about 15-20 minutes.
- 3
Blend the Soup
Using an immersion blender, blend the soup until smooth. Alternatively, transfer to a blender in batches and blend until creamy.
- 4
Finish with Cream
Stir in the heavy cream and season with salt and black pepper to taste. Heat through gently.

Crouton Preparation
- 6
Prepare Croutons
Preheat the oven to 180°C (350°F). Toss the cubed bread with olive oil and black pepper. Spread on a baking sheet and bake until golden and crispy, about 10-15 minutes.
Final Assembly
- 7
Serve
Ladle the velouté into bowls, drizzle with herb oil, top with black pepper croutons, and finish with a drizzle of truffle oil.
